You know what caught me off guard about Wairakei Resort? It’s actually way more relaxed than I expected for a 4-star place. I mean, when you pull up that long drive off Wairakei Drive – and honestly, GPS can be a bit wonky finding the exact entrance – you’re greeted by this sprawling property that feels more like a country retreat than your typical hotel. The geothermal steam rising in the distance immediately reminds you where you are, and there’s this earthy, mineral smell in the air that’s pure Taupo.
The rooms are comfortable enough, though I’ll be honest, some feel a bit dated (the carpeting especially), but here’s the thing – you’re not really here to hang out in your room anyway. What makes this place special is how it sits right in the heart of geothermal country. You can literally walk to the Craters of the Moon thermal area, which most tourists don’t realize is basically next door. The resort’s own geothermal pool is pretty decent – not fancy, but the water’s naturally heated and perfect after a day of exploring. I actually prefer it in the evenings when it’s quieter and you can hear the bubbling mud pools nearby. The restaurant’s nothing to write home about, but the staff genuinely seem to know the area well. Our server gave us directions to this little café in Wairakei village that we never would’ve found otherwise.
Here’s what I really appreciated – parking’s easy (a huge plus when you’re lugging hiking gear), and they’re used to guests coming and going at odd hours for sunrise lake visits or late dinners in town. It’s about a 10-minute drive to central Taupo, which means you avoid the tourist crowds but can still hit up the lakefront restaurants. The 7.3 rating feels about right – it’s not going to blow you away, but it does exactly what it promises. Perfect if you want to explore the geothermal wonders without paying resort prices, and honestly, waking up to those misty views over the thermal valley is worth the slightly worn edges. Just bring a jacket – even in summer, those geothermal winds can be chilly in the mornings.
